Monthly climate in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France

Last updated: March 2, 2024

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ne features a oceanic climate (Cfb). Temperatures typically range between 3 °C (38 °F) and 22 °C (72 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-12 °C (10 °F) or can rise to as high as 39 °C (103 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 1039 mm (40.9 inches) and receives 139 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ne enjoys an average of 3576 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 8 hours 42 minutes to 15 hours 39 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France §

The warmest months in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ne are June, July and August,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 20 to 22 °C (69 - 72 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in January, February and December, when daily mean temperatures range from 3 to 6 °C (38 - 43 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ne experiences 69 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 40 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France §

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ne usually has the most precipitation in May, October and December, with an average of 14 rainy days and 117 mm (4.6 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ne are January, February and April. On average, 63 mm (2.5 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France §

The sunniest months in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ne are June, July and August, when the sun shines an average of 13 hours 12 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ne: January, November and December receive an average of 5 hours 45 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France §

Saint-Etienne-la-Varenne exper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in June, July and August,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 8 - 9, which corresponds to the Very High category of sun exposure. January, February and December are in the Low / Moderate ex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 3.
